on error resume next vba function

 

 

 

 

On Error Resume Next.NETWORKDAYS Function In Excel. Sum Cells based on Background Color. Getting Familiar with VB Editor (VBE) : VBA Basics 002. I have been reading many posts where I see "On Error Resume Next" being used As well as " On Error GoTo 0" (which basicallyI was working for a telemarketing company who used VB5/VB6/VBA for just about all reporting because all cleint Похоже, что у вас установлена неправильная опция захвата ошибок. В редакторе VBA выберите Tools -> Options.On Error Resume Next Set ws ThisWorkbook.Sheets(wsName) On Error GoTo 0. If Not ws Is Nothing Then DoesWSExist True End Function. включаем обработку ошибок On Error Resume Next.Windows проводник - обзор и запуск под администратором. Урок 11 по JScript - конструкция switchcase. Урок 5 по VBA - Объявление локальных и глобальных переменных. оператора Resume любого вида Exit Sub, Exit Function, Exit Property оператора On Error любого вида.On Error Resume Next только для ограниченного набора строк - VBA Есть макрос, который сталкивается со множеством неожиданностей, и выбрасывает ошибки тут и Exit Sub Exit Function. Перепишем немного листинг учебной программы, который использовался на позапрошломДля обработки ошибок в VBA и VB есть специальный оператор On Error.И не только я так думаю, создатели VBA тоже так считали, и поэтому есть оператор Resume Next.

Если ошибка возникает в процедуре, содержащей оператор On Error Resume Next, процедура продолжает выполнение со строки, слелущей непосредственно за ошибочной, причем сообщение об ошибке подавляется. Visual Basic Script урезан в своих возможностях по обработке ошибок в отличие от своего большого брата.То же самое происходит при использовании операторов: On Error Resume Next, Exit Sub, Exit Function. Youve been in the right place to see examples On Error Resume Next Vba. By looking at resume samples will be easier for us to write a resume properly. You can create a summary of a wide variety of your work experience in your resume. Be careful when using the "On Error Resume Next".Disables any enabled error handler in the current procedure This is used to turn VBA errorthe following line of code at the end of a procedure (or function) as error handling in a procedure (or function) is automatically disabled when the Even if any fatal unexpected error occurs in the code then also you should ensure that the code should terminate gracefully. Cancel Toggle navigation Home About HTML Tutorial VBA Error Handling On Error Resume NextThis macro code enables the On Error Resume Next function.ExplanationTo The term end statement should be taken to mean End Sub , End Function, End Property, or just End.

It is very important to remember that On Error Resume Next does not in any way "fix" the error. It simply instructs VBA to continue as if no error occured. В настройках редактора VBA поставь опцию break on unhandled errors. 25 май 05, 11:16 [1570004] Ответить | Цитировать Сообщить модератору.Private Function RecordsetSetErr(Optional ByVal ErrN, Optional ByVal ErrD) On Error Resume Next Call MsgBox("Ошибка при получении данных I think the solution should be with: On Error Resume Next N 1 / 0 cause an error If Err.Number <> 0 Then.Runtime error 13: Type mismatch. These can be caught with VBAs IsError function. Dim rw As Long. excel vba error handling next resume. More: Pause and resume a c function. on error goto on error resume next и т.д. Цитата. при появлении подобных и любых других ошибок они автоматически обрабатывались.Прикрепленные файлы. ErrorHandlingVBA.PNG (28.97 КБ). Visual Basic Visual Basic for Applications VBA, Visual. If you are looking for a quick summary then. Calling Worksheet Functions From VBA. On Error Resume Next basically at the beginning of the script. For i 7 To Range("Count").Value. On Error Resume Next. Workbooks.Open Cells(i, 1).Text.Hello experts, I need help cant understand where to put part for error in my long VBA code. On Error Resume Next Application.ScreenUpdating False. If Not fso.FileExists(LocalContactsPath) Then. If MsgBox("The contacts file is not available.excel replace function in acces vba. 0. These can be caught with VBAs IsError function. Dim rw As Long With ThisWorkbook.Sheets(TsSh) For rw StRw To LsRw If IsError(.Cells(rw, 1)) Then .Cells(rw, 1).Interior.ColorIndex 10 ElseIf Not CBool(Len(.Cells(rw, 1).Value2)On Error Resume Next will ignore the fact that the error occurred. Таким образом, вместо неприятных сбоев будет происходить изящное завершение работы макроса. Для того, чтобы помочь справиться с возникающими ошибками, VBA предоставляет разработчику операторы On Error и Resume.Resume Next Exle Excel Visual Basic On.Write Text File Vba Excel.Pmo Manager Resume Sles Fashion Marketing Resume Skills Resumes For Sales Representative.Disable On Error Resume Next Vba.Resume Letter Sle Resume Letter Sle Pdf Resume Cover Letter Exles Social Work в конец процедуры добавить оператор Exit Sub (или Exit Function), за котор рым должен следовать программный код обработчика ошибок On Error Resume Next дает указание VBA игнорировать строку программного кода, ставшую причиной ошибки, и продолжить выполнение To enable On Error Resume Next will make the VBA program skip code that generates an error and normally stops the program.The error function is turned off in case of error just continue On Error Resume Next. Пособие-самоучитель on-line "Visual Basic с нуля". Глава 11. Перехват и обработка ошибок. Операторы On Error и Resume. Объект Err.Операторы ON ERROR и RESUME (Resume Next). in second Visual Basic Language Reference Statements F-P Statements F-P Statements On Error Statement On Error Statement On Error Vba On Error Resume Next Turn Off Statement For Each Next Statement For Next Statement Function Statement Get. Jan 28, 2014VBA Error Handling RESUME. For rowcounter 1 To 10 On Error Resume Next Execute query On Error GoTo ErrorHandler MSAccess, VBA and error.Example (as VBA Function) The FORNEXT statement can only be used in VBA code in Microsoft Excel. On Error Resume Next - Указывает, что возникновение ошибки выполнения приводит к передаче управления на инструкцию, непосредственно следующую за инструкцией, при выполнении которой возникла ошибка. On Error GoTo endbit: raise an error Err.Raise 69 Exit Sub endbit: On Error GoTo 0. On Error Resume Next WB.Sheets("x").Columns("D:T").AutoFit.Ive found that in functions/subs that iterates over nested objects, errorhandling might be a drag in VBA. A solution that works for me to better От таких случаев неожиданной остановки макроса отлично помогает On Error Resume Next.Compile error: Next without For - VBA. Не выводит фирму телевизора кол-во которого было отремонтировано меньше всего. On Error Resume Next Application.ScreenUpdating False. If Not fso.FileExists(LocalContactsPath) Then.Hello there fellow StackOverflow users, So my issue is with a workbook that heavily uses VBA to automate and calculate several functions. Errors1: MsgBox ("Ну ты блин Тикурила Даещь"). Resume Next.Resume. Exit Sub(Function). On Error. При отладке или специально в программе вы и сами можете сгенирировать ошибку методом Raise, только надо знать, что ошибки до 1000 зарезервированы VBA, а Excel Vba Basics 16b Errors Continue Your Macro Even.Goto.On Error Resume Vb.Vba On Error Resume Next Exle. The Err objects Raise method is useful to regenerate an original error in a vba procedure - refer the section on Error Object for details on the Raise Method.Using an Exit Sub, Exit Function or Exit Property statement, or using Resume Next statement in an error-handling routine, automatically calls Office VBA Reference Language Reference VBA Оператор On Error.

Примечание Конструкция On Error Resume Next может оказаться предпочтительнее On Error GoTo при обработке ошибок, возникших в процессе доступ к другим объектам. On Error Resume Next Application.ScreenUpdating False. If Not fso.FileExists(LocalContactsPath) Then.Ignore Number Stored as Text Error in Excel programmatically using VBA. VBA Excel Error Handling - especially in functions - Professional Excel Development Style.next vba, doc 9381 error resume next vba excel 28 related docs www clever, vba on error resume goto, copy cells from the activecell row to a databasenext vba, excel visual basic on error resume next definekryptonite x fc2, excel vba basics 16b errors continue your macro even with errors using Excel это не сложно Основные форумы Вопросы по Excel и VBA Многократная обработка ошибок.Есть такая конструкция: On Error Resume Next, которая игнорирует ошибки. Так же у объекта Err есть метод Clear. On error resume next - после такого оператора, VBA будет игнорировать возникшую ошибку и передавать управление на следующий оператор, стоящий за тем, в котором возникла ошибка. On error goto 0 - это режим по-умолчанию. This macro code enables the On Error Resume Next function. Explanation. To enable On Error Resume Next will make the VBA program skip code that generates an error and normally stops the program.A basic example file of the VBA macro is available for download at the bottom of this web Support for Windows Products. Home > Vba On > Access 2010 Vba On Error Resume Next.Each procedure, then, will have this format (without the line numbers): 1 handling errors in vba Sub|Function SomeName() 2 On Error GoTo ErrSomeName Initialize error handling. Как восстановить обработку ошибок после команды «On Error Resume Next»? Объявлением новой строки « On Error »If an error occurs while an error handler is active (between the occurrence of the error and a Resume, Exit Sub, Exit Function, or Exit Property statement), the The On Error Resume Next construct may be preferable to On Error GoTo when handling errors generated during access to other objects. Checking Err after each interaction with an object removes ambiguity about which object was accessed by the code. On Error Resume Next - just continues to the next line if an error occurs.Excel VBA - How to Check if File Exists (Dir function) - Продолжительность: 2:57 InAnOffice 6 085 просмотров. Vb6 On Error Resume Next Cool Microsoft Visual Basic On Error .Function Check If Folder Exists IAccessWorld Com . Online Advance Excel VBA Training In India . Excel Vba Resume Lovely Resume Next Vba Pictures Inspiration . Операторы On Error, Resume, объект Err. Информация из интернета: Ошибки в VBA можно разделитьFunction RR1. On Error Resume Next область действия только на эту функцию. Scope 28 Images Vba Showing The Updates Being Performed By Macro.Vba Resume Next 28 Images Free Graphic Design Resume Psd TheError Resume Next Exle Excel Visual Basic On.Customer Support Resume Objective Sales Sle Resume Cover Letter Sle Coaching Resume.On Error Resume. A basic example file of the VBA macro is available for download at the bottom of this web page, or just copy and paste the code directly from this page. In many cases it is done clever to enable the on error resume next function because the bugs in your code will not be easily found. On Error Resume Next x y /0 No error raised. On Error Goto 0 Disable any previous VBA error handling.Clearing I dont want to have duplicate error message descriptions lying around the place. A simple Get function can help Function wsExists(wksName As String) As Boolean On Error Resume Next wsExists Len(Worksheets(wksName).Name) On Error GoTo 0 End Function. Explanation of VBA code Custom Function to check if worksheet exists.

related posts